Umpiretalk Ltd London

Store Address Umpiretalk Ltd London, 145-157 St John Street Map to store Umpiretalk Ltd London, 145-157 St John Street

Umpiretalk Ltd London

Umpiretalk Ltd, London, 145-157 St John Street, Sports

145-157 St John Street
London
EC1 V4PW

Open hours Umpiretalk Ltd London

Monday -
Tuesday -
Wednesday -
Thursday -
Friday -
Saturday -
Sunday -

Shopping near

Shopping near shops Umpiretalk Ltd London
  1. Royal Mail The Hyde London
  2. Putney Cabs, 02082543388, Cabs Sw15 London
  3. Earl's Court Cabs, 02082543388, Cabs Sw5 London
  4. Footasylum Croydon London